@mozzab Just let sky do the OTS service and they take care off it all for you! Once sky inform VM you should in theory get an e-mail/text etc from VM notifying you of the fact that Sky are going to be taking over! From time to time it can go wrong so there is no 100% that it goes a smooth as you wish, so keep the eye on it!
Payment side you need to forget about that, VM may have a refund for you, sky payment start's the day you go live, and payment is taken 6-7 day's after that, if there is an overlap that is JUST unavoidable, so you may end up paying sky and VM with VM refunding the OVERPAYMENT at a later date! Computer generated once it raises the bill it's on the way and nothing is stopping it!!!
